We accidentally stumbled upon this restaurant thinking it was a different restaurant we had originally wanted to try. Luckily it turned out to be the best choice! From the looks of the restaurant, it has a down-home, country feel. I guess I was anticipating the food to be average. I was completely blown away with the quality and creativity of each item on the menu!
I had ordered the veggie slaw as an appetizer, the pork shoulder as my main entree, and the roasted white eggplant for dessert. Everything was phenomenal! We had stayed in France for about two weeks and this restaurant was one of my absolute favorites, even including the fine dining restaurants we had eaten at.
The wait staff is extremely friendly, knowledgable and helpful. He was very attentive and went above and beyond to make sure our meal was enjoyable. The entire experience was quite lovely.

We were told this was an innovative chef. They were not kidding. A cold carrot soup with just the right amount of ginger topped with thyme ice cream. What?? Beautiful little restaurant. A gorgeous pork shoulder was cooked perfectly. Presentation was everything. One of our favorite dining experiences in France.

Such a cool place to have dinner. This place is a non assuming restaurant on a random side street but wow does it deliver. Some dishes are better then others but if you choose well, you will be very pleased! La Fee (The Fairy) Gourmande has a very creative chief and if you like taking photos of your food, this is the place to do it! This place has loads of positive reviews on trip advisor and was recommend to us. Worth a stop if you like out there creative food and flavors. I mean goat cheese ice cream (creme glace eve chèvre) in a cold soup or in a salad!!? I must report it was fabulous. Lavender ice cream is my all time favorite which you can find across Arles. Missing Lavender ice cream right about now!
